.amh-app-banner{max-width:var(--wp--custom--layout--section-max-width);margin-inline:var(--wp--preset--spacing--20);border-radius:var(--wp--custom--border-radius--lg);background:#eee;overflow:hidden}.amh-app-banner__inner{display:grid;grid-template-columns:1fr}@media(min-width:768px){.amh-app-banner__inner{grid-template-columns:[full-start] minmax(var(--wp--preset--spacing--20),1fr) [content-start] minmax(0,calc(var(--wp--style--global--wide-size) / 2)) [center] minmax(0,calc(var(--wp--style--global--wide-size) / 2)) [content-end] minmax(var(--wp--preset--spacing--20),1fr) [full-end];align-items:stretch}}.amh-app-banner__content{align-self:center;padding:var(--wp--preset--spacing--60) var(--wp--preset--spacing--30) 0}@media(min-width:768px){.amh-app-banner__content{grid-column:content-start / center;padding:var(--wp--preset--spacing--60) var(--wp--preset--spacing--50) var(--wp--preset--spacing--60) var(--wp--preset--spacing--20)}}.amh-app-banner__heading{font-size:var(--wp--preset--font-size--3-xl);line-height:var(--wp--custom--line-height--tight);margin-bottom:var(--wp--preset--spacing--20)}.amh-app-banner__text{line-height:var(--wp--custom--line-height--relaxed);margin-bottom:var(--wp--preset--spacing--30);max-width:38ch}.amh-app-banner__hint{color:var(--wp--preset--color--neutral-500, #6b7280);font-style:italic}.amh-app-banner__actions{display:flex;flex-wrap:wrap;gap:var(--wp--preset--spacing--10);align-items:center}.amh-app-banner__media{overflow:hidden}@media(min-width:768px){.amh-app-banner__media{grid-column:center / full-end}}.amh-app-banner__img{display:block;width:100%;height:auto}@media(min-width:768px){.amh-app-banner__img{height:100%;object-fit:cover;object-position:bottom right}}@media(min-width:768px){.amh-app-banner--image-left .amh-app-banner__content{grid-column:center / content-end;padding:var(--wp--preset--spacing--60) 0 var(--wp--preset--spacing--60) var(--wp--preset--spacing--50)}.amh-app-banner--image-left .amh-app-banner__media{grid-column:full-start / center}.amh-app-banner--image-left .amh-app-banner__img{object-position:bottom left}}.amh-app-banner__placeholder{display:flex;align-items:center;justify-content:center;width:100%;min-height:100%;aspect-ratio:16 / 9;color:var(--wp--preset--color--neutral-500, #6b7280)}
